ELEC-C7222
Libraries for ELEC C7222 Course Work
Loading...
Searching...
No Matches
c7222::Platform Member List
This is the complete list of members for
c7222::Platform
, including all inherited members.
CreateLedPwm
(PicoWBoard::LedId id, uint8_t dim)
c7222::Platform
DisableButtonIrq
(PicoWBoard::ButtonId id)
c7222::Platform
inline
EnableButtonIrq
(PicoWBoard::ButtonId id, GpioInputEvent events, std::function< void(uint32_t)> handler)
c7222::Platform
inline
EnsureArchInitialized
()
c7222::Platform
GetButton
(PicoWBoard::ButtonId id)
c7222::Platform
inline
GetInstance
()
c7222::Platform
static
GetLed
(PicoWBoard::LedId id)
c7222::Platform
inline
GetOnBoardLed
()
c7222::Platform
inline
GetOnChipTemperatureSensor
()
c7222::Platform
inline
GetPicoWBoard
()
c7222::Platform
inline
Initialize
()
c7222::Platform
IsButtonPressed
(PicoWBoard::ButtonId id)
c7222::Platform
inline
IsInitialized
() const
c7222::Platform
inline
LedOff
(PicoWBoard::LedId id)
c7222::Platform
inline
LedOn
(PicoWBoard::LedId id)
c7222::Platform
inline
NonCopyable
()=default
c7222::NonCopyable
protected
NonCopyable
(const NonCopyable &)=delete
c7222::NonCopyable
NonCopyable
(NonCopyable &&)=default
c7222::NonCopyable
NonCopyableNonMovable
()=default
c7222::NonCopyableNonMovable
protected
NonMovable
()=default
c7222::NonMovable
protected
NonMovable
(const NonMovable &)=default
c7222::NonMovable
NonMovable
(NonMovable &&)=delete
c7222::NonMovable
c7222::operator=
(const NonCopyable &)=delete
c7222::NonCopyable
c7222::operator=
(NonCopyable &&)=default
c7222::NonCopyable
c7222::NonMovable::operator=
(const NonMovable &)=default
c7222::NonMovable
c7222::NonMovable::operator=
(NonMovable &&)=delete
c7222::NonMovable
SleepMs
(uint32_t ms)
c7222::Platform
static
SleepUntil
(std::chrono::steady_clock::time_point target)
c7222::Platform
static
SleepUs
(uint64_t us)
c7222::Platform
static
TightLoopContents
()
c7222::Platform
static
ToggleLed
(PicoWBoard::LedId id)
c7222::Platform
inline
~NonCopyable
()=default
c7222::NonCopyable
protected
~NonCopyableNonMovable
()=default
c7222::NonCopyableNonMovable
protected
~NonMovable
()=default
c7222::NonMovable
protected
Generated by
1.9.8